From your Lynqu card, tap Add to Wallet and the pass is saved to Apple Wallet or Google Wallet in seconds. Your QR code is then one swipe away whenever you need to share your details.
Yes. Once saved, your wallet pass and its QR code work without an internet connection, so you can share your card even when you have no signal.
Yes. The pass links to your live Lynqu card, so updates to your role, phone number, or links are reflected automatically — no need to re-add the card.
No. Anyone can scan your wallet card's QR code with their phone camera to open and save your contact details — they don't need an account or the Lynqu app.
Digital wallet business cards are contact passes stored in Apple Wallet or Google Wallet on your phone. Once added, your card is always accessible — even offline and without an app. Share it by tapping your phone or showing the pass's QR code. When you update your Lynqu card, the wallet pass updates automatically so contacts always have your latest info.

Wallet integration moves your card from a URL to an OS-level pass — with both upsides and constraints worth knowing.
Wallet passes render natively in iOS and Android. The QR code on the back scans even on a flight, in a basement, or with airplane mode on. No browser tab, no JavaScript, no battery cost.
Change your phone number, headshot, or job title in Lynqu and Apple or Google’s pass-update protocol delivers the new version to every device that holds your card. No re-sharing the link, no “please save my new info” email.
iOS promotes recently-used passes to the lock screen and the Wallet widget; Android surfaces them from the home-screen Wallet stack. A card you used yesterday at a meetup surfaces the moment you walk into the follow-up coffee.
